I am part of a website that has all kinds of information about soccer and coaching soccer that I have used over the past few years as one of my many resources on continuing to learn how to be a better coach. In the not too distant past, they have started offering free video clips from many of the DVDs they recommend on their site. Now, I am not telling anyone to go buy any of these DVDs but I would encourage you to get your kids to watch some of the video clips. In my opinion, some are better than others but I haven't really seen any yet that are bad. Just like when I encourage everyone to go watch a soccer match, I believe there is a lot to be learned from "seeing" the game and, althought these are only clips, it could help the kids to see some of the things I try to teach them. Even if it doesn't actually teach them a new skill, it can make them aware and maybe open a discussion during practice about how to do some things.
